New fashion appointments at ELLE
ELLE magazine has appointed Poppy Evans as fashion director, marking her rise from intern to the most influential fashion position in the local magazine industry in less than five years.
At 24, Evans is also the youngest fashion director in ELLE's history. She follows in the footsteps of Chris Viljoen, Jackie Burger (now the magazine's editor) and the late Sue Ferrier. As fashion director she heads up a team of six, including fashion editors Asanda Sizani and Tarryn Oppel, another new appointment.
